Everything but the romance was good!

I am watching this now, after realizing I may have not finished this drama. After watching this now, I get all the nostalgia back from the green flag Awesome Sis (Tavia)'s family and her relationship with her detective co-workers. I always love HK dramas for their natural chemistry. Every scene with them felt as if I was in the scene too with them, all happy and smiling.

The cases were decent, but nothing that got me on my toes. The cases get progressively more serious. I remember this one scene scared me as a kid, but now it's like child's play.

One major flaw would be the guys of this drama. Toxic men be getting their way here. Gordon is your player who flirts with every girl and Kingsley King (what an iconic name) is a big wimp who can't even protect his girlfriend in front of his fam MULTIPLE times. How can both just end up getting the girl just because they want them? Sorry doesn't cut it, especially when Awesome and Nickole have expressed how hurt they were because of them. Letting men get their way is not the message to be sending here, but Asian countries love that male dominance and toxic masculinity. The ending literally sucked because of that. Don't know what's up with the dating, to breakup, and then straight to marriage.
